Output d43fcab75c4f833c7ec32cd9d4ddbf2ffbb949efbe619b1cbf90e99a2c741a4d:0

value
132579552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f906e046d72a4f3f60ff97ab6761bf869a6b5ca3 OP_EQUAL
address
3QPkR4u2mnPUYUmMjhpFFRrfJR5ZPwCCJN
transaction
d43fcab75c4f833c7ec32cd9d4ddbf2ffbb949efbe619b1cbf90e99a2c741a4d
confirmations
524635
spent
true